Nausori Pastor who is on the run sentenced to 14 years imprisonment for rape and sexual assault

The Pastor of Hindi Christian Fellowship Church, Ravinesh Chand who raped and sexually assaulted a 15 year old girl in Nausori last year and is still on the run, has been sentenced to 14 years imprisonment.

Prosecution lawyer, Swastika Sharma told the court that they were unable to execute the bench warrant as Chand's phone is switched off and they cannot locate his family.

While sentencing Chand this morning, High Court Judge, Justice Daniel Goundar says Chand's conduct is disgraceful as a spiritual leader and he had no respect for the child's dignity.

Justice Goundar says the victim was also emotionally affected by the incident as she contemplated killing herself.

He says the sentence will start from the date Chand is arrested.

A non-parole period of 11 years has been set.
